wheedling
noun[ U ]
uk /ˈwiː.dəl.ɪŋ/ us /ˈwiː.dəl.ɪŋ/
the act of trying to persuade someone to do something by saying nice things about them: 哄骗;用花言巧语说服;诓骗
The rule will spare you endless wheedling and whining from your child.这条规则会让你免受孩子无休止的哀求和抱怨。
By patient wheedling and soft talk I managed to persuade her.通过耐心的劝说和软磨硬泡,我成功地说服了她。
